2012年10月3日 星期三

From relational databases to distributed/parallel databases to cloud databases


課程 : 論文研討(一)
日期 : 2012/09/28
時間 : 13:50 ~ 15:30
地點 : S104
作者 : 資工研一 林益亘
講者 : 國立政治大學 陳良弼教授


這次的演講對我來說相當吃力,有一段時間沒有在上有關資料庫的課程聽起來有點陌生,但還好關鍵字當相當容易理解,這次演講者先從三種資料庫開始介紹,關聯式資料庫的開發及它具有的種特徵。分散式資料庫是將資料分別儲存在不同電腦上,運用網際網路連結成一個大的資料庫。並聯式資料庫則是使用多個CPU和硬碟來加快處理的能力。最後介紹雲端資料庫,這是整個研討會的重點,雲端資料庫顧名思義就是資料庫在雲端電腦上執行,在這裡又分成兩種資料庫SQL資料庫與NoSQL資料庫,其中SQL資料庫是目前較為常見的資料庫,該資料庫的大小較難擴充,但相對的NoSQL資料庫很容易擴充。
目前大多使用的關聯式資料庫在使用join的時候是非常花時間的,在需要及時抓出資訊的時候非常緩慢。NoSQL在下面節的網站中有指出它基本的五個觀念(http://www.ithome.com.tw/itadm/article.php?c=63360&s=4)
觀念 1  NoSQL是Not Only SQL 
觀念 2 增加機器就能自動擴充資料庫容量 
觀念 3 打破Schema欄位架構的限制
觀念 4 資料遲早會一致 
觀念 5 成熟度不足,版本升級風險高 


沒有留言:

張貼留言